Ademir Kenović (born September 14, 1950) is a Bosnian film director
and producer.He graduated from the University of Sarajevo in 1975. In
1972â€"73 he studied film, English literature and art at the Denison
University in Ohio. His films include Kuduz (1989) and A Little Bit of
Soul (1987). His 1997 work The Perfect Circle won the François
Chalais Prize. He also produced the popular 2004 Bosnian film Days and
Hours.
